WebThe first naturalization law, passed in 1790, allowed free whites who’d lived in the United States for two years and the same state for one year apply for citizenship. In 1795, the residency requirement was increased to five years, and applicants had to give three years’ notice of their intention to naturalize before they could become citizens.
